Once you have your Cricut cutting machine, you will need a cutting mat for sure to hold the material while the machine cuts it. The mats come in varying sizes and also grip strength. The mats have a different color for the different grips so that helps to keep them separate and not confuse them.

You have your Cricut machine and cutting mat, but now you need a few tools that will make your crafting life a whole lot easier. Cricut has an Essential Tool Set with 7 tools that is perfect for those getting started. All the tools included help with all the different materials you will be cutting. The set includes a paper trimmer that can cut materials up to 12” wide along with a replacement blade for the trimmer. There is also a scoring blade that you can interchange when needing to add score lines to a project such as cardmaking, papercrafts, paper boxes, etc.

Below is a picture of the other tools included and a list of them (from left to right) so you know exactly what each tool does and is used for. (Still crushing over this mint. Eek!)

What Tools and Accessories do I Need to use a Cricut and How Much do They Cost?

  • Scraper: to burnish material and clean all cutting mats
  • Scissors: to cut different materials, also includes a blade cover
  • Tweezers: to lift and secure delicate material
  • Weeder: to remove tiny negative cuts
  • Scoring stylus: to add fold lines to cards and envelopes
  • Spatula: to lift cuts from the mat

(Above info from Cricut.com)

Now do you technically have to have every single tool I mentioned above to complete a project using the Cricut? You do NEED the mat! The other tools are EXTREMELY helpful when completing projects, especially those that have very tedious and tiny cuts. Once the Cricut has finished cutting my material and I’ve removed the cutting mat, I peeled back the larger section of negative vinyl. This picture shows you the back of the holographic vinyl and that gorgeous pink color that shines through.

What Tools and Accessories do I Need to use a Cricut and How Much do They Cost?

Using the weeder, start removing the other negative vinyl. The sharp tip of the weeder is perfect for getting the vinyl pulled up and then you can just peel it back. The weeder also helps to remove even the tiniest, most intricate cuts that nothing else can usually.

What Tools and Accessories do I Need to use a Cricut and How Much do They Cost?

I cut a section of the transfer tape and pulled the backing off while I adhered the tape to the top of my vinyl cut.

What Tools and Accessories do I Need to use a Cricut and How Much do They Cost?

I removed the entire cut with the backing of the vinyl still intact and the transfer tape on top. This just makes it easier to work with to remove the backing from the vinyl.

What Tools and Accessories do I Need to use a Cricut and How Much do They Cost?

Using the transfer tape, adhere the vinyl cut to your rain boot and burnish the vinyl. You really just want to make sure the entire vinyl cut is adhered with no air bubbles or wrinkles. This is where the scraper comes in handy to rub the vinyl down evenly. The layer of transfer tape will then easily peel away from the vinyl  and rain boot.
